Dear Lactnetters,
        Please help me find information about finding Donor Milk for a newborn
whose mother is critically  ill. This couple were in my Lamaze class that
ended just before the holidays. She developed toxemia last week and the
baby ( a little girl) was born this past Saturday at 35 weeks gestation.
About 12 hours after giving birth this mama "crashed" going into severe
HELLP and with several other complications. She is in ICU and yesterday
was given a 15% chance of pulling through this,(prayer  would be welcome
:-)
        Daddy is wanting only breastmilk for his daughter and is amazed that the
nursery seems to disregard their wishes ( no paci, nuk nipplesonly, etc.)
Unfortunately, alternative forms of feeding are not within the policy and
those of us who know how have to be sneaky.....He is concerned about Jen
being able to breastfeed after all this. I gave him reassurance as best I
could without saying the obvious. We did talk about the use of Donor Milk
and I know that I once saw a post on Lactnet about ordering milk to be
sent in where no human milk  bank is available. We are in Louisville ,
Kentucky. Daddy is very much interested in finding out what he can do to
get this milk for his baby girl "until" mama can breastfeed herself. He
said that breastfeeding was something he and Jen had decided to put 100%
of their effort into and now that everything else has gone wrong he feels
that getting Donor Milk for the baby is the one thing he CAN do to help.
        Thanks in advance for your help. They are such a sweet couple and very
young.
